Student Resources

Beyond the classroom, Lamplighter students benefit from a strong network of support services and specialized faculty.

The School employs a full-time, on-site School Nurse and a full-time School Counselor who provide care and guidance throughout the school day. In addition, three full-time faculty members work closely with students to provide targeted literacy and math extension and support, ensuring each child receives the resources needed to thrive.

Lamplighter also holds parent-teacher conferences four times each year to strengthen the partnership between school and home while maintaining consistent communication about each student’s progress and developmental growth.

Extension

Lamplighter’s full-time Literacy Specialist and Math Specialist provide extension for students in Kindergarten through fourth grade, working in small groups to extend and strengthen classroom learning. Support

Lamplighter offers targeted literacy, math, speech, and occupational therapy support through full-time faculty and outside partners. Our Math Specialist works with small groups of students to strengthen foundational math skills. Our full-time Certified Academic Language Therapist provides specialized instruction during the school day for students diagnosed with dyslexia. Lamplighter also partners with The Shelton Speech and Language Clinic and Dallas Outpatient Therapy Services for Kids (DOTS) to allow students to receive speech, language, and occupational therapy services on Lamplighter's campus and within the regular school day. Parents coordinate these services through the partners, with the support of Lamplighter's School Counselor.

Barn & Gardens

Barn & Gardens is a student-created literary magazine written, photographed, and designed entirely by fourth grade students. Working in small groups with the School’s Literacy Specialist, Lamplighter Seniors develop each issue over the course of a semester, selecting features and collaborating with partners or teams to produce their sections. The magazine is published twice each year and shared with the Lamplighter student body.
